Perte de données dans cartouche SW+PDM

Bonjour à tous,
Je travaille dans une équipe de 6 dessinateurs projeteurs et on est tous sous SW avec PDM. On est tous paramétrés de la même manière. Il y a un an environ, j’ai changé de PC et depuis la réinstallation du pack SW+PSM, lorsque je créé un plan ou que c’est moi qui valide un plan (passage attente de validation > Bon Pour Execution) je perds systématiquement les 3 infos du cartouches : Echelle / Format / Page. Si j’ouvre un plan Bon Pour Execution dans SW, les 3 infos sont là et disparaissent une demie seconde après l’ouverture du plan.

Si je fais valider le plan par un collègue, ces 3 informations reviennent. Elles ne sont certes pas essentielles à la compréhension du plan mais c’est quand même important de les avoir surtout pour des fournisseurs qui ont besoin de précision. Du coup je ne valide plus de plan et ça peut devenir problématique durant des périodes où personne d’autre ne peut valider.

Voici le cartouche d’une pièce test en pdf validée par un collègue

Le même cartouche depuis le plan ouvert dans SW avec mon PC

J’ai bien vérifié les liens des templates cartouches et j’ai les mêmes que mes collègues. On pense qu’il y a un conflit avec la langue car mon SW a été installé en anglais et d’après la société IT engagée par mon employeur - qui a fait l’installation - on ne peut pas changer la langue après coup, il faudrait réinstaller SW entièrement ainsi que le PDM (une demi journée à distance). Je précise également que je ne peux rien faire de moi-même niveau installation software car tout est soumis à un mdp admin uniquement utilisable par un responsable IT de mon employeur.
Aussi, en vérifiant les paramètres du plan dans custom, les lignes Echelle / Format / Page n’apparaissent pas et il est impossible d’en ajouter en faisant Edit List.

Je ne sais plus où chercher et c’est vraiment très spécifique j’ai l’impression, si quelqu’un sait, merci d’avance :wink:

Bonjour,

Il faut commencer par voir ce que vous avez comme appel de propriété dans vos fond de plans.
Normalement ça devrait être ça pour l’échelle :
image

Nb : il faut « Editer le texte dans la fenetre » pour voir le $PRP:« SW-Sheet Scale » lors de l’édition

Vous avez peut être la traduction française $PRP:« SW-Echelle de la feuille » dans vos modèles de fond de plans.
Utiliser la version anglaise dans vos modèles devrait résoudre le pb pour vous (et ne devrait normalement pas avoir d’incidence pour vos collègues : faites un test sur une nouvelle version de votre fond de plan et faites un rollback si cela met le bazar pour vos collègues).

$PRP:« SW-Taille du fond de plan(Sheet Format Size) » →
$PRP:« SW-Sheet Format Size »

et
$PRP:« SW-Feuille actuelle(Current Sheet) »/$PRP:« SW-Nbre total de feuilles(Total Sheets) » →
$PRP:« SW-Current Sheet »/$PRP:« SW-Total Sheets »

ATTENTION : l’éditeur Visiativ a modifié mes guillemets

Nb : je pense que ce n’est pas pour rien que SW a rajouté le texte de base en anglais entre parenthèse sur les versions récentes ( 2020 l’a déjà) : pouvoir facilement modifier le nom de l’appel de propriété afin d’avoir un truc universel simplement. Le truc ‹ rigolo › c’est que l’aide française SW2020 a gardé la vieille syntaxe : sans la traduction entre parenthèse.
La traduction entre parenthèse permet bien d’avoir un truc universel (ligne 2 ci dessous dans l’image qui fonctionne alors que la 3 buggue).
Un exemple avec l’allemand (non installé sur mon poste)
image

2 « J'aime »

Refaites un modèle de plan de votre coté en recreant ces formules qui ne fonctionnent pas, donnez les à vos collègues et voyez si ils les lisent

Merci beaucoup à vous deux pour ces précieuses infos. C’est déjà incroyable pour moi que vous ayez mis le doigt direct sur le problème.

Après avoir atteint la zone d’édition (non sans mal car elle est vide et il faut la trouver), j’ai pu modifier l’appel de propriété en ajoutant le texte en anglais entre parenthèses. Ca fonctionne tant que je ne sors pas de l’édition de fond de plan. Dès que je sors, les infos disparaissent. C’est aussi pour cette raison qu’on ne voit pas l’info Size/Format ci-dessous car il est sur un autre bloc et donc idem, si je ne suis pas dedans l’info n’apparait pas.

Mon collègue à modifié le template source de la même manière et ça donne exactement le même résultat : j’ouvre un plan au hasard, je mets à jour le lien du template (ici A3), les infos apparaissent seulement si on va dans le fond de plan puis qu’on clique sur Edit.

J’ai fait des Ctrl+B et Ctrl+Q, enregistré le plan, archivé, fermé, rouvert puis extrait à nouveau. Ca ne veut pas.
En faisant nouveau plan c’est la même chose.

Il semblerait qu’il y ait autre chose qui bloque.

Bonjour,
Jamais eu ce problème, quelle version de SW?

SolidWorks Premium 2023

Juste une précision, quand vous dites bloc. La note est dans un bloc ?
Il me semble qu’elles ne sont pas recalculées automatiquement donc il faut mettre la note directement dans le fond de plan

2 « J'aime »

@Cyril_f
C’est peut être bien la source du problème car chez nous les notes sont bien dans le fond de plan en direct (et pas dans un bloc qui serait sur le fond de plan).

Et moi qui voulais mettre des blocs liés à ma bibliothèque dans mes fonds de plan via cette case à cocher dont je viens de prendre connaissance pour pouvoir plus facilement faire une maj de cartouche :sob:
image

De mon côté, le cartouche est un bloc inséré dans le fond de plan avec la liaison conservé de sorte à ce que tous les plans pris en édition se mette à jour automatiquement si le bloc cartouche est modifié.
Jamais eu de soucis pour la mise à jour des notes contenues dans le bloc.

L’important est de définir les attributs !!

1 « J'aime »

Merci @Silver_Surfer

Donc pour toi les blocs (contenant des $PRP) fonctionnent bien dans les fond de plans et ton fond de plan se met à jour automatiquement lors de l’ouverture si jamais il a été modifié entre le moment de création du plan et sa réouverture ?

Je me disais que c’était une bonne idée de mettre des blocs liés au fichier dans les fonds de plan et une confirmation de ta part serait la bienvenue.

La preuve :

2 « J'aime »

Merci pour la preuve (et pour les galons de vérificateurs :rofl:)

1 « J'aime »

Tout ça ne résout pas le problème de l’ami @Valentin_Unic_SA

Est-ce que vos informations format, échelle et pages n/n appelle des valeurs de propriété et ses propriétés appellent des propriétés par défaut (SW-…) ?

Exemple :
Dans les propriétés de la mise en plan : Format = $PRP:« Taille du fond de plan(Sheet Format Size) »
Dans le cartouche : Note = $PRP:« Format »

Si oui, vérifier la présence des propriétés dans le fichier après ouverture.

1 « J'aime »

Bonjour;

Ne serait-ce pas lié aux réglages des Feuilles de mises en plan ?